Remi Tinubu to Fashola: During your first tenure, I didn’t get any employment for my constituents
Senator representing Lagos Central Senatorial District, Oluremi Tinubu, told Babatunde Fashola (a minister nominee) that her constituency didn’t get any employment slots during his first tenure as Minister of Power, Works and Housing.
The senator said this during Fashola’s ministerial screening at the National Assembly on Monday.

Remi Tinubu further urged Fashola to remember her constituency this time around if appointed as Minister.
“My only addition is that during your first tenure, I remember I didn’t get any chance to give employment letter to my constituency.
“So, when you get there this time, just remember Senators here that have people back home. My constituents are asking us for employment slots. So, I want you to put that in your agenda for next tenure.
“We all need a slot for employment for our constituents,” Remi Tinubu said.
Meanwhile, Senator Remi was also quick to add that Fashola who was also a former governor of Lagos State is fit and competent to serve as a minister of the Federal Republic of Nigeria again.
